Output 186215aeab656f5d131b59f7bd1ed364d50fb8a107aa28e9ab00380df5123b59:778

value
5154
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b8617269ef4e78147c58ac1a38aac1ac4c53aae1e3dc7537b3d23df41e1dc93
address
ltc1ptwrpwf577nncz3793tq68z4vrtzv2w4wrc7uw5mm853a7s0pmjfsyjanyx
transaction
186215aeab656f5d131b59f7bd1ed364d50fb8a107aa28e9ab00380df5123b59
spent
true